Basic Information

Product Name (2S,3S,4Ar,6R,8Ar)-2,3,4A,5,6,8A-Hexahydro-7-Iodo-2,3-Dimethoxy-2,3,6-Trimethyl-1,4-Benzodioxin-6-Ol
CAS No. 888723-97-5
Molecular Formula C₁₃H₂₁IO₅
Molecular Weight 384.21 g/mol
Synonyms 7-Iodo-2,3-dimethoxy-2,3,6-trimethyl-1,4-benzodioxan-6-ol; (2S,3S,4aR,6R,8aR)-7-Iodo-2,3-dimethoxy-2,3,6-trimethyl-1,4-benzodioxan-6-ol; Hexahydro-7-iodo-2,3-dimethoxy-2,3,6-trimethyl-1,4-benzodioxin-6-ol; CAS 888723-97-5; Iodinated Benzodioxin Derivative; Advanced Chiral Intermediate; Pharmaceutical Building Block 888723-97-5

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ry place at a controlled room temperature (15-25°C). This compound is light-sensitive and should be handled under appropriate conditions to maintain stability. For long-term storage, consider inert atmosphere packaging.
